A comparative study of various recommendation algorithms based on E-commerce big data

被引:0
作者
Jin, Zishuo [1 ]
Ye, Feng [1 ]
Nedjah, Nadia [2 ]
Zhang, Xuejie [1 ]
机构
[1] Hohai Univ, Coll Comp Sci & Software Engn, Nanjing, Peoples R China
[2] Univ Estado Rio De Janeiro, Rio De Janeiro, Brazil
关键词
ALS algorithm; TF-IDF algorithm; Item-CF algorithm; Recommendation system; Spark;
D O I
10.1016/j.elerap.2024.101461
中图分类号
F [经济];
学科分类号
02 ;
摘要
With the rapid development of the Internet and the concomitant exponential growth of information, we have entered an era characterized by information overload. The abundance of data has rendered it increasingly arduous for users to pinpoint specific information they require. However, various forms of recommendation algorithms proffer solutions to this challenge. These algorithms predict items or products that may pique users' interest based on their historical behavior, preferences, and interests. As one of the current hot research fields, recommendation algorithms are extensively employed across E-commerce platforms, movie streaming services, and various other contexts to cater to the diverse needs of users. In this context, a multi-recommendation algorithms comparison platform is proposed, which includes a two-fold model: online evaluation and offline evaluation. Taking the data set of the Chinese Amazon online shopping mall as the experimental data, item-based collaborative filtering (Item-CF) algorithm, content-based (TF-IDF) algorithm, item2vec model, alternating least squares (ALS) algorithm and neural network algorithm are evaluated in the offline model. In the real-time recommendation part, model-based algorithm is used to achieve the users' rating mechanism. And the metrics used for evaluation include: precision, recall, accuracy and performance. The experimental results show that the average performance of hybrid algorithms such as ALS algorithm and neural network algorithm is higher than that of other traditional algorithms, and the real-time recommendation system achieves the purpose of improving recommendation speed. By integrating various recommender algorithms into the multi- recommendation algorithms comparison platform, this platform automatically computes and presents various performance indicators based on the user-provided dataset. It aids E-commerce platforms in making informed decisions regarding algorithm selection.
引用
收藏
页数:13
相关论文
共 43 条
  • [11] Hao Wang, 2022, Design and Implementation of News Recommendation System Based on Spark Framework
  • [12] Hao Zhang, 2018, Decision Support Technology for City Road Traffic Congestion Safety Evacuation Based on Case Based Reasoning
  • [13] Bayesian dual neural networks for recommendation
    He, Jia
    Zhuang, Fuzhen
    Liu, Yanchi
    He, Qing
    Lin, Fen
    [J]. FRONTIERS OF COMPUTER SCIENCE, 2019, 13 (06) : 1255 - 1265
  • [14] Neural Collaborative Filtering
    He, Xiangnan
    Liao, Lizi
    Zhang, Hanwang
    Nie, Liqiang
    Hu, Xia
    Chua, Tat-Seng
    [J]. PROCEEDINGS OF THE 26TH INTERNATIONAL CONFERENCE ON WORLD WIDE WEB (WWW'17), 2017, : 173 - 182
  • [15] Leveraging attribute latent features for addressing new item cold-start issue
    Hsieh, Mi-Tsuen
    Lee, Shie-Jue
    Wu, Chih-Hung
    Hou, Chun-Liang
    Ouyang, Chen-Sen
    Lin, Zhan-Pei
    [J]. ELECTRONIC COMMERCE RESEARCH AND APPLICATIONS, 2022, 54
  • [16] [黄立威 Huang Liwei], 2018, [计算机学报, Chinese Journal of Computers], V41, P1619
  • [17] Jian Jiao, 2020, Design and Implementation of Electronic Commerce Recommendation System Based on Spark
  • [18] Jie Wang, 2018, Research on Sentiment Classfication Based on Emotional Dictionary and Deep Learning Technology
  • [19] Ke Ji, 2016, Research on Hybrid Collaborative Filtering Recommendation Algorithma Combining Context
  • [20] The Dynamics of Viral Marketing
    Leskovec, Jure
    Adamic, Lada A.
    Huberman, Bernardo A.
    [J]. ACM TRANSACTIONS ON THE WEB, 2007, 1 (01)